Address

31h4KKHDBwybFxckmpmoJQHJ2iKLBoaqH6

0 BTC

Confirmed
Total Received0.14 BTC
Total Sent0.14 BTC
Final Balance0 BTC
No. Transactions2

Transactions

31h4KKHDBwybFxckmpmoJQHJ2iKLBoaqH60.14 BTC